<p dir="auto">关系式驱动参数之间的数学关系：</p>
<p dir="auto">齿轮关系式示例：<br />
m = 2 (模数)<br />
z = 20 (齿数)<br />
d = m<em>z (分度圆直径)<br />
da = d+2</em>m (齿顶圆)<br />
df = d-2.5*m (齿根圆)</p>
<h2>族表(Family Table)</h2>
<p dir="auto">族表用于管理相似零件的变体：</p>
<ol>
<li>创建基础模型</li>
<li>添加可变参数</li>
<li>生成族表</li>
<li>添加各实例的参数值</li>
</ol>
<h2>应用场景</h2>
<ul>
<li>标准件库：螺栓/螺母/垫圈</li>
<li>模架系列：不同尺寸模架</li>
<li>零件变体：长中短版本</li>
<li>参数化设计：输入参数驱动全模型</li>
